Output 24edb0800ee0d3f508996521379e6ac1fab2ebac7440a1cf35bff1e51b7b6121:34

value
266641934
script pubkey
OP_0 OP_PUSHBYTES_20 ec62aacf00e245b5f6b4b1a7cd90254a5ef13a02
address
bc1qa3324ncqufzmta45kxnumyp9ff00zwszv3amep
transaction
24edb0800ee0d3f508996521379e6ac1fab2ebac7440a1cf35bff1e51b7b6121
spent
true